On a number line, the numbers start with zero and get larger as they move to the right, They are negative and get smaller as they move to the left from the zero. To find which number is greater, you can find the places of two numbers on the line and the one on the right is greater.

Any three numbers where the sum of the two smaller numbers is greater than the third number. List the numbers in order from least to greatest, repeating any number if necessary. Add the first two numbers together and if this sum is greater than the third number then a triangle with those sides can be made. ie if the sum of the two smaller numbers is greater than the third number then a triangle can be made.
